Understanding Double Glazed Patio Doors
Double glazed patio doors include two panes of glass with a sealed gap in between them, filled with air or an inert gas like argon. This design boosts insulation, reduces noise, and enhances energy performance. The doors can be hinged, sliding, or folding, and are typically made from products like aluminum, uPVC, or wood.
Typical Issues and Their Causes
Condensation Between Panes
Cause: A breach in the seal in between the panes permits moisture to get in, causing condensation.Solution: Replacing the whole glazed unit is often needed.
Broken or Damaged Glass
Cause: Impact from objects or severe climate condition.Option: Replacing the harmed pane or the entire unit, depending upon the degree of the damage.
Sticking or Difficult to Open/Close
Trigger: Misalignment, worn-out rollers, or debris in the track.Service: Adjusting the door positioning, replacing rollers, or cleaning up the track.
Drafts and Leaks
Cause: Worn-out seals, gaps, or damaged frames.Service: Replacing seals, filling spaces, or fixing the frame.
Sound and Vibration
Cause: Loose components, bad installation, or aging products.Solution: Tightening loose parts, resealing, or changing elements.Do it yourself vs. Professional Repairs

Q: How frequently should I examine my double glazed patio door?
A: It's recommended to examine your double glazed patio door at least once a year. More regular assessments may be necessary if you live in an area with extreme climate condition.
Q: Can I replace the glass in a double glazed unit myself?
A: Replacing the glass in a double glazed unit is a complicated job that needs specialized tools and knowledge. It's normally advised to work with an expert to make sure the brand-new unit is properly sealed and set up.
Q: What should I do if I see condensation between the panes?
A: Condensation in between the panes suggests a breach in the seal. The entire glazed unit will need to be replaced to restore the door's functionality and energy performance.
